Grease and flour a 9" x 5" loaf pan or line with parchment paper. Set aside.
In a large mixing bowl, whisk dry ingredients: flour, soda, salt and spices.
In another mixing bowl, combine butter, molasses and water. Whisk until butter is melted. Cool until not hot to the touch. Add egg and whisk until well combined.
Add w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and whisk until the batter is smooth.
Pour into prepared pan and bake in preheated oven for 35 minutes OR until the toothpick inserted in few places in the center of the cake comes out clean.
Cool completely.
Dust with powdered sugar and slice.
Notes
Keep wrapped in plastic wrap or in an air-tight container for up to 5 days.This cake can be baked in a loaf pan, muffin pan or a 9" square or round pan. I like the loaf shape and that's what I use. You can frost the cake with a cream cheese frosting ( get my favorite recipe for it, here ) or dust it with powdered sugar.
